That's what was intended but while filming the scene, Harvey Keitel's squib (explosive charge used to simulate gun shot) went off at the same time that he shot Lawrence Tierney (Joe). Chris Penn's squib went off right afterward and so he just fell down when everyone else did. Tarentino admitted that it was a mistake but left the scene as is.
